Well did you update to ICS with sim card and SD card connected then there will be some issues after update. So follow the steps below to repair it.

1) Go to settings -> Backup & reset -> Factory data reset -> select Erase SD card and click reset phone button (This will wipe the SD card and settings before the repair-please make sure to backup contacts and data)

     ** To backup contacts Go to Contacts -> click options button(the button at the right) -> click Back up contacts -> select SD card (back file will located at System -> PIM folder in SD card)

2) Install Sony update service - http://www-support-downloads.sonymobile.com/Software%20Downloads/Update_Service_Setup-2.11.12.5.exe

3) Switch off the phone and remove the sim card and the SD card(Do not switch on untill prompt by software)

4) Now follow the on screen instructions properly. Make sure to select "Reset settings and update" option rather than "Recommended - update with all the apps currently installed" option.

After reading the forum trying out stuff, experimenting, re-installing, upgrading/downgrading.... here is what i found. At least on my xperia arc i can re-create the issue 100% of time. Every time the phone goes into GSM mode instead of CDMA it just re-boots. The settings-mobile networks.... i changed it from "gsm/wcdma preferred" to "wcdma only". putting it on "GSM only" makes it goes into cyclic re-boot which you can come out using SUS (sony upgrade service). Mostly yhe phones are on setting "gsm/wcdma preferred", so when one goes into area with weaker signals the phone tries to move from wcdma to gsm and bam!!! re-boot. Also swithcing on blue-tooth makes the phone go into gsm mode and again ...reboot. 

I have put my phone to WCDMA only setting and its been 2 months without a "random" reboot. This works both on 2.3 and 4.0.  urrently the phone is on 4.0 official release without any problem.
